What Are Goethe Certificates?

Goethe Certificates, also called the "Goethe-Zertifikat," are internationally recognized German language efficiency tests used by the Goethe-Institut, a cultural organization that promotes the German language and culture worldwide. The certificates are based on the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which divides language proficiency into 6 levels: A1, A2, B1, B2, C1, and C2. Each level corresponds to a particular set of language skills and competencies.

Levels of Goethe Certificates

A1: Breakthrough

  • Description: At this level, candidates can comprehend and utilize familiar everyday expressions and very fundamental phrases aimed at the fulfillment of needs of a concrete type.  Göthe Zertifikat  can present themselves and others and can ask and answer questions about personal details such as where they live, people they know, and things they have.
  • Test Format: The A1 exam consists of reading, composing, listening, and speaking areas.

A2: Waystage

  • Description: Candidates at this level can comprehend sentences and often used expressions associated to areas of the majority of instant relevance (e.g., personal and family information, shopping, regional geography, work). They can communicate in basic and regular jobs requiring a simple and direct exchange of info on familiar and regular matters.
  • Test Format: The A2 exam consists of reading, composing, listening, and speaking sections.

B1: Threshold

  • Description: At this level, candidates can understand the bottom lines of clear standard input on familiar matters regularly encountered in work, school, leisure, and so on. They can deal with many situations most likely to develop while traveling in a location where the language is spoken and can produce easy linked text on topics that recognize or of personal interest.
  • Test Format: The B1 exam covers reading, composing, listening, and speaking sections.

B2: Vantage

  • Description: Candidates at this level can comprehend the main ideas of complicated text on both concrete and abstract subjects, consisting of technical discussions in their field of specialization. They can engage with a degree of fluency and spontaneity that makes routine interaction with native speakers quite possible without stress for either celebration.
  • Test Format: The B2 exam consists of reading, composing, listening, and speaking areas.

C1: Effective Operational Proficiency

  • Description: At this level, candidates can understand a large range of requiring, longer texts and recognize implicit significance. They can express themselves fluently and spontaneously without much apparent searching for expressions and can utilize language flexibly and successfully for social, academic, and expert purposes.
  • Test Format: The C1 exam includes reading, composing, listening, and speaking sections.

C2: Mastery

  • Description: Candidates at this level can understand with ease practically everything they hear or check out. They can summarize info from various spoken and written sources, rebuilding arguments and accounts in a coherent discussion. They can express themselves spontaneously, very fluently, and specifically, distinguishing finer tones of implying even in more complex circumstances.
  • Test Format: The C2 exam includes reading, composing, listening, and speaking sections.

Advantages of Goethe Certificates

Professional Advancement

  • Task Opportunities: Many worldwide companies and organizations require or prefer candidates with qualified German language skills, particularly in nations where German is spoken.
  • Career Development: Goethe Certificates can boost one's resume and open doors to higher-level positions and much better profession potential customers.

Academic Pursuits

  • University Admissions: Many German universities and academic organizations need Goethe Certificates for admission to undergraduate and graduate programs.
  • Scholarships and Grants: Some scholarships and grants for research study in Germany or German-speaking countries may require a Goethe Certificate as evidence of language proficiency.

Individual Growth

  • Cultural Understanding: Learning German and getting a Goethe Certificate can deepen one's understanding of German culture and history.
  • Travel and Communication: Proficiency in German can boost travel experiences and facilitate interaction in German-speaking countries.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What is the age requirement for taking a Goethe Certificate exam?

  • A: There is no specific age requirement for taking a Goethe Certificate exam. However, the Goethe-Institut provides different exams for children and teens, such as the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1 and the Goethe-Zertifikat A2: Start Deutsch 2.

Q: How frequently are Goethe Certificate examinations offered?

  • A: Goethe Certificate tests are used several times throughout the year at various test centers all over the world. The exact dates and areas can be found on the Goethe-Institut's official website.

Q: How long does it take to get the results?

  • A: The results for Goethe Certificate exams are typically readily available within 4-6 weeks after the test date. However, this can vary depending upon the level and area.

Q: Can I retake the exam if I do not pass?

  • A: Yes, you can retake the Goethe Certificate exam as numerous times as required till you achieve the preferred level of proficiency. Nevertheless, you might need to await the next arranged exam date.

Q: Are Goethe Certificates acknowledged worldwide?

  • A: Yes, Goethe Certificates are internationally recognized and are widely accepted by universities, companies, and federal government companies worldwide as proof of German language proficiency.
